Job Description
Seeking a licensed pediatric speech-language pathologist to provide communication services at a school in Chestnut Ridge, NY, with an adapted Waldorf curriculum tailored for students with social, sensory, and developmental challenges.
- Deliver center-based therapy to children from kindergarten to 21 years old with speech/language delays, autism, apraxia, and related needs.
- Conduct evaluations, develop IEPs, and implement evidence-based intervention strategies using play, verbal, sign, and AAC methods.
- Educate staff and families on therapy techniques and adapt equipment as needed.
- Maintain accurate documentation, participate in training, and collaborate with a multidisciplinary team.
Qualifications include a Master’s in Speech-Language Pathology, NY licensure, TSSH/TSSLD certification, and at least 2 years of pediatric experience. Knowledge of Waldorf philosophy and feeding therapy skills are a plus. The role offers competitive pay, benefits, and professional development opportunities.
